Publisher's Synopsis

Planning to go on a boating trip and hoping to avoid a Gilligan’s Island-type situation? Whether you’re just getting into boating or have been doing it for years, this is the ultimate handbook to have on deck. Unlike other reference guides, this one is rugged, durable, and splash-resistant in a zip-around, waterproof cover, guaranteeing that even if the seas get rough, your handy guide won’t leave you stranded with running ink and blotted pages. The same innovative thinking and attention to detail has gone into preparing the contents. This is the ultimate portable reference to all kinds of boats, including information about power boats, sailboats, jet skis, yachts, canoes, kayaks, and more. With illustrated sections covering everything from how to get started and finance your new hobby to keeping the family fed and entertained onboard, this book gives practical advice for all scenarios and situations. It’s one of the only boating guides to include cooking information, survival techniques, and fun family activities, perfect for all of the 71 million boaters in the country.

About the Publisher

Running Press

Running Press Publishers has been providing consumers with an innovative list of quality books and book-related kits since 1972. Running Press creates more than 80 new titles a year under four imprints: Running Press, Running Press Kids, Running Press Teens, and Running Press Miniature Editions™. Titles cover a broad range of categories, including: humor and essay, food and wine, performing arts, lifestyle and craft, children's illustrated picture books and award winning young adult fiction. Miniature Editions has the original and most innovative kit program in the industry, from abridged bestsellers, best licensed properties, to our clever and quirky in-house created kits. Running Press is headquartered in Philadelphia, PA, and is a proud member of the Perseus Books Group.
